
Jennifer Villalba
Jennifer Villalba is a fifth-year medical student at UNISUD in Paraguay who recently gained recognition for her innovative work in clinical simulation. She achieved second place at the VII Latin American Congress on Clinical Simulation and Patient Safety held in Bogotá, Colombia, where she presented her project on an anatomical simulator for training in central venous access and ultrasound-guided thyroid puncture. Villalba's project stood out among 90 scientific proposals from across the region, highlighting the quality of education at UNISUD and showcasing Paraguay's potential in medical simulation.
